COSMEDICON 2024 is set to wow delegates.

The event runs over four days from Thursday, 7 March through to Sunday, 10 March and is endorsed by the Australian College of Nursing (ACN), the Australasian College of Aesthetic Medicine (ACAM) and the Cosmetic Physicians College of Australasia (CPCA).

Driven by delegate feedback, the program has been tweaked to maximise the education benefits for attendees. Thursday is now Workshop Day, with the Scientific Program and Trade Exhibition running concurrently on Friday and Saturday, with Sunday featuring case studies and live injecting demonstrations.

The conference will again be held at Sydney’s Intercontinental Hotel, Double Bay. Delegates can expect to learn about the latest innovations in aesthetic treatments, as well as tips and tricks from experienced key opinion leaders.

Scientific program

The COSMEDICON 2024 two-day scientific program has been curated to ensure the inclusion of an impressive cross-section of international and local key opinion leaders, providing thought-provoking, skill-enhancing presentations and discussions over a range of acutely relevant subjects. These include the latest techniques and technologies in minimally invasive aesthetic practice, covering facial rejuvenation/injectables, body sculpting, skincare and EBs, as well as a regulations review.

Hot topics:

  • Semaglutide for weight loss – Keynote speaker and world-renowned expert Prof Steven Boyages explains in detail and answers your questions.
  • Exosomes – various experts explain not only the basics, but also the use in combination with other therapies for various indications.
  • Ultrasound – a number of experts explain the use of ultrasound for skin tightening, guided dissolving of fillers and its use in plastic surgery.
  • Live injecting demonstrations and Case study reviews – expert instruction from the cream of aesthetic medical practitioners highlighting at the latest products and techniques, as well as reviewing issues that may arise.

Dr Glen Calderhead (South Korea)

Based in South Korea as Vice-President, Medicoscientific Affairs of the Lutronic Corporation, Dr Calderhead travels worldwide lecturing on all aspects of phototherapy and photosurgery. He is a prolific lecturer at national and international congresses, having given over 300 keynote and special invited lectures over the past 30 years.

A pioneer of laser surgery both in Japan and world- wide, Dr Calderhead is a leading expert in low level light therapy (LLLT). He became interested in LEDs as a valid phototherapeutic light source following the development of the “NASA LED”, which offers laser-like target selectivity.

He has published a number of scientific papers and is the co-author of and contributor to several books on laser therapy, laser surgery and simulation surgery.
